Is It Normal for My Girlfriend to Hit Me? 10 Possible Reasons

In any relationship, it is essential to prioritize open communication, respect, and a foundation of trust. However, when physical violence enters the picture, it can lead to confusion, fear, and feelings of helplessness. If you find yourself asking, “Is it normal for my girlfriend to hit me?” it is important to address this issue seriously and seek the necessary support.

Understanding Domestic Violence

Domestic violence is a form of abuse that can occur in any relationship, regardless of gender. It encompasses physical, emotional, sexual, financial, or spiritual abuse perpetrated against a family member or romantic partner. It is crucial to recognize that intimate partner violence is never acceptable or normal, regardless of the gender of the victim or perpetrator.

Reasons for My Girlfriend to Hit Me? Exploring Possible Reasons

When trying to make sense of your girlfriend’s violent behavior, it is essential to approach the situation with empathy and understanding. While the reasons for her actions may vary, here are some potential explanations:

1. Past Trauma

Your girlfriend may have experienced past trauma, such as being a victim of domestic violence herself. This unresolved trauma can sometimes manifest as physical violence towards others. While empathy is crucial, it does not excuse or justify her actions.

2. Need for Control

Physical violence can be a means for your girlfriend to gain control over the relationship. By resorting to violence, she may manipulate and dominate you, leading to a power imbalance. It is important to recognize that control should never be established through violence.

3. Learned Behavior

If your girlfriend grew up in an environment where physical violence was normalized or witnessed abuse within her family, she may believe that violence is an acceptable means of communication. It is important to break this cycle and establish healthy ways of resolving conflicts.

4. Mental Health Issues

Sometimes, underlying mental health conditions can contribute to violent behavior. Conditions such as anger management issues or untreated mental illnesses can impair one’s ability to control emotions and actions. Encouraging your girlfriend to seek professional help is crucial in addressing these underlying issues.

5. Lack of Communication Skills

In some cases, individuals resort to physical violence when they struggle to effectively communicate their emotions or needs. Your girlfriend may believe that hitting you is the only way to make you understand her frustrations or concerns. Promoting healthy communication strategies can help address this issue.

6. Substance Abuse

Substances like alcohol or drugs can impair judgment and contribute to aggressive behavior. If your girlfriend is engaging in substance abuse, it is important to address this issue alongside the violence. Encouraging her to seek help for her addiction can be a crucial step towards a healthier relationship.

7. Anger and Frustration

Feelings of anger and frustration can sometimes lead individuals to act out violently. If your girlfriend is struggling with managing her anger, it is important to find healthier outlets and coping mechanisms for her emotions.

8. Low Self-Esteem

Individuals with low self-esteem may resort to violence as a way to exert control or cope with their insecurities. It is important to support your girlfriend in building her self-worth and confidence in healthier ways.

9. Jealousy and Insecurity

Feelings of jealousy and insecurity can sometimes trigger violent behavior. If your girlfriend feels threatened by others or believes she is not receiving enough attention or affection, she may resort to physical violence. Open and honest communication about these insecurities is essential.

10. Lack of Respect

Respect is the foundation of any healthy relationship. If your girlfriend doesn’t respect you or your boundaries, she may resort to physical violence as a means of asserting her dominance. It is important to establish clear boundaries and demand respect in the relationship.

What to Do If Your Girlfriend Hits You

Experiencing physical violence in a relationship can be emotionally and physically distressing. Here are some steps you can take if your girlfriend hits you:

1. Prioritize Your Safety

Your safety should always be the top priority. If you fear for your safety or believe you are in immediate danger, remove yourself from the situation and seek help from authorities or a trusted support network.

2. Seek Professional Help

Dealing with domestic violence requires professional guidance and support. Consider reaching out to a therapist, counselor, or support hotline specializing in domestic violence. They can help you navigate the complexities of the situation and provide valuable resources.

3. Establish Boundaries

Communicate your boundaries clearly and assertively. Let your girlfriend know that physical violence is not acceptable and that you will not tolerate it. If she continues to engage in violent behavior, it may be necessary to reevaluate the relationship.

4. Encourage Open Communication

Promote open and honest communication within the relationship. Encourage your girlfriend to express her feelings and concerns in non-violent ways. Seek couples therapy or relationship counseling to improve communication skills and address underlying issues.

5. Set Limits

If your girlfriend continues to exhibit violent behavior despite your efforts to address the issue, it may be necessary to set limits or establish consequences. This could involve seeking legal protection or considering separation if your safety is at risk.

6. Focus on Your Well-being

Prioritize your mental health and well-being throughout this process. Engage in self-care activities, seek support from friends and family, and consider individual therapy to process the emotional impact of the violence.

8. Educate Yourself

Take the time to educate yourself about domestic violence, its effects, and the resources available to you. Knowledge empowers you to make informed decisions and seek appropriate support.

9. Consider Your Options

Evaluate the overall dynamics of the relationship and consider whether it is healthy and beneficial for both parties involved. If the violence persists and your safety is at risk, it may be necessary to consider ending the relationship.
